To have WebConnex working, you only need a url, user name and password. On-Line Communications can get this all working and your existing phone numbers can be moved to the platform.
So what can WebConnex do? Here’s a list of its features:
- Click-to-dial (from Outlook, documents and web pages)
- Click-to-conference
- Screen and document sharing
- Shared whiteboard
- High-definition video conferencing
- Presence tells you who is available and how they can be reached
- Direct integration with Microsoft Office, Microsoft Outlook and Microsoft Teams
